Large equipment

Raman Spectrometer

  • To Overview
  • »
  • 9 / 190
  • »

Technical University of Vienna

Wien | Website

Open for Collaboration

Short Description

This Raman spectrometer offers a time-gating technology that enables the fluorescence background subtraction. The device provides information on both Raman scattering and time-resolved fluorescence. PicoRaman M3 spectrometer is equipped with a pulsed 532 nm laser, immersion probe and flow-cell. The immersion probe is compatible with the standard bioreactor port and it is; therefore, suitable for online monitoring of bioreactor cultivations. PicoRaman M3 brings the same benefits as conventional Raman spectrometers. Additionally, the measurement is immune to ambient light, and high-temperature measurements are possible by providing suppression of thermal emission interference. The spectrometer is suitable for a wide range of applications from biological samples to materials or environmental analysis. It is possible to measure solids, liquids and even gaseous samples.
